Frequently Asked Questions
What are the vaccination requirements for my dog to attend daycare in Clarion?
Most Clarion daycares, like those following Iowa state guidelines, require proof of up-to-date vaccinations for Rabies, DHPP (Distemper, Hepatitis, Parainfluenza, Parvovirus), and Bordetella (kennel cough). Some facilities may also recommend the canine influenza vaccine. Always check with your chosen daycare for their specific list, and your local Clarion veterinarian can help you get your pet's records in order.

What should I pack for my dog's first day of daycare?
For a successful first day, pack a labeled leash and collar (a simple, flat collar is safest for play). You should also provide your dog's food in pre-portioned bags if they are staying through a mealtime. While toys from home are usually not allowed to prevent resource guarding, feel free to bring any required medication with clear instructions. It's also wise to ensure your dog has a recent flea and tick treatment, common in Iowa's rural areas.
How do you handle dogs that aren't social or get overwhelmed?
Many Clarion daycares understand that not all dogs are social butterflies. They often offer separate areas or quiet times for shy, senior, or less social dogs. Be sure to discuss your dog's temperament during the initial evaluation. Staff can provide one-on-one attention or structured, low-energy activities to ensure every dog has a safe and positive experience without the pressure of a large, boisterous playgroup.
Are there any local Clarion considerations, like severe weather policies?
Yes, given Iowa's severe weather, it's important to ask about a daycare's emergency plans. This includes policies for early closure during tornado warnings or winter blizzards. You should also inquire about their outdoor play areas—how they are secured, shaded, and maintained in different seasons. Furthermore, with Clarion's proximity to farmland, ask if the facility takes extra precautions against potential exposure to agricultural chemicals tracked in on footwear.
